新疆早二叠世 Kepingophyllum aksuense Wu et Zhou的内生长线发育良好,它们是由年季节温度的变化而形成的.据内生长线,可推算出k. aksuense Wu et Zhou的平均生长率为5mm/年.运用珊瑚的生长率及年龄可计算出沉积事件发生的频率.
Growth lines are abrupt or repetitive changes in the character of an accreting tissue including shells and skeletons, and these changes are usually related to changes in the environment (Clark, 1979).There are various expressions of growth lines. Those annual lines of trees and shellfish were first noticed, which can be seen as differences in color, thickness, relief, or shading. For this reason, they can be recognized in two categories: external growth lines visible on the surface of organisms such as shells, corals; and internal growth lines visilb in thee section of pears, some corals and so on (Text-fig. 1).
